McCormick & Company, Incorporated Price Performance

Shares of MKC traded down $0.05 on Thursday, reaching $69.38. The stock had a trading volume of 193,877 shares, compared to its average volume of 2,287,500. The firm has a 50-day moving average of $73.14 and a 200 day moving average of $75.91. The firm has a market capitalization of $18.62 billion, a PE ratio of 24.06, a PEG ratio of 3.35 and a beta of 0.66. The company has a quick ratio of 0.27, a current ratio of 0.68 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.55. McCormick & Company, Incorporated has a twelve month low of $69.13 and a twelve month high of $86.24.

McCormick & Company, Incorporated (NYSE:MKC -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, June 26th. The company reported $0.69 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.65 by $0.04. The firm had revenue of $1.66 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.67 billion. McCormick & Company, Incorporated had a return on equity of 14.43% and a net margin of 11.50%. McCormick & Company, Incorporated's quarterly revenue was up 1.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$0.69 EPS. Sell-side analysts expect that McCormick & Company, Incorporated will post 3.07 EPS for the current year.

McCormick & Company, Incorporated Company Profile

(Free Report)

McCormick & Co, Inc engages in the manufacturing, marketing, and distribution of spices, seasoning mixes, condiments, and other flavorful products to retail outlets, food manufacturers, and foodservice businesses. It operates through the Consumer and Flavor Solutions segments. The Consumer segment sells spices, seasonings, condiments, and sauces.
